Demographic insights for Epsom and Ewell 009f
The population of Epsom and Ewell 009f is on average 43 years old with men making up 47% and females making up 53% of the entire local residental population
Epsom and Ewell 009f residents are mostly Straight or Heterosexual (91.6%) with the majority being Married: Opposite sex (50.0%)
Residents of Epsom and Ewell 009f that are classed as students account for 21.29% of the population, 0.87% above the overall national average. Of those that are not currently studying, 76% have 5+ GCSE/O-levels which is 4.00% above the overall national average.
83% of the local population were born in the UK and 92% have lived in Epsom and Ewell 009f for 3 years or more.
